guardare

guardare vt (con lo sguardo) (= osservare); to look at [+ film, televisione]; to watch (= custodire); to look after, take care of
vito look (= badare): guardare a → to pay attention to; [luoghi] (= esser orientato): guardare a → to face;
guardarsi vrto look at o.s;
guardare di → to try to;
guardarsi da (= astenersi) → to refrain from (= stare in guardia); to beware of;
guardarsi dal fare → to take care not to do;
ma guarda un po'! → good heavens!;
e guarda caso ... → as if by coincidence ...;
guardare qn dall'alto in basso → to look down on sb;
non guardare in faccia a nessuno (fig) → to have no regard for anybody;
guardare di traverso → to scowl o frown at;
guardare a vista qn → to keep a close watch on sb
